Plans are underway by the Rotary Clubs of the Sunshine Coast exploring the idea of starting a multi day program mirroring the Prince George model but altering it to suit the needs of the high school students and the partner/sponsors who will be delivering the program. More information as it becomes available.
The original health care program in Prince George exposes high school youth to what are typically roles that often have face-to-face contact with patients for the purpose of diagnosis, treatment, and ongoing care. Some clinical professions are behind-the-scenes, such as laboratory professionals whose work supports diagnosis and treatment
The professions explored with hands on experiences where direct patient care is normally provided cover a wide range from physician, nursing, ,psychiatry, chemistry, biology, to allied professionals including medical technologist, medical lab technicians, physio and occupational therapy,, respiratory therapy, dietitics, radiography, sonography, radiography and pharmacy.
The launch of a 2nd program will be held in Terrace this May, 2023. Open to grade 10 and 11 students from both Terrace and Kitimat.
